Who says you cannot choose your family?

The race for the state Senate's District 27 seat is a relative affair.

Democrat incumbent Catherine Miranda is running against Democrat Maritza Miranda Saenz, her stepdaughter.

Both Catherine and Maritza are related to the late Ben Miranda, a long-time state legislator. Political consultant David Waid, who has consulted for Phoenix Mayor Greg Stanton, tells ABC15 that it is a heated contest.  

"My overall take on that race is that it's got all of the drama of the 'Game of Thrones,'" Waid said. "There are so many different pieces going on, it's actually very high stakes."

The Aug. 30 primary between the Miranda ladies all but determines who takes the District 27 seat, which primarily represents South Phoenix. 

A Republican challenger has yet to emerge in the race.
